Evolution of Space Communication Technology

Early space missions encountered significant communication challenges. During the initial operations of space stations such as Salyut and Mir, astronauts faced issues like static-filled radio transmissions and frequent communication blackouts.

These technical limitations often resulted in delayed or inconsistent contact with mission control, contributing to the astronauts' feelings of isolation during their missions.

In contrast, the International Space Station (ISS) benefits from advanced communication technologies, which allow for real-time video calls, instant email, and social media interactions.

These improvements enable astronauts to maintain relationships with family and friends as well as engage with the public through various platforms, such as Twitter and personal blogs.

The enhanced communication capabilities on the ISS represent a significant evolution from earlier missions, improving the overall quality of life for astronauts in space and fostering a sense of connection to those on Earth.

Such developments highlight the ongoing advancements in space communication technology and its impact on human space exploration.

Leveraging Social Media Platforms in Orbit

Astronauts in orbit have increasingly utilized social media platforms such as Twitter and Instagram to document and share their experiences from the International Space Station (ISS) with a global audience. For instance, European Space Agency (ESA) astronaut André Kuipers regularly shares photographs and updates that illustrate both the scientific work being conducted in space and the personal experiences of living aboard the ISS.

The introduction of advanced communication technologies has made it feasible for astronauts to provide real-time insights into their daily routines and experiments, a capability that was limited in earlier missions due to less sophisticated communication tools. The use of social media serves multiple functions; it not only informs the public about space activities but also helps maintain crew morale by fostering connections with family members and supporters on Earth.

Furthermore, platforms such as Flickr and dedicated blogs allow for the documentation of various aspects of life in space, contributing to a richer understanding of the day-to-day realities faced by astronauts. This visibility can enhance public interest in space exploration and support for space agencies, while also serving educational purposes by providing direct access to space-related content.

Addressing Communication Challenges in Space

Despite advancements in communication technology, astronauts still encounter significant challenges when connecting with Earth from space. Historically, early space missions experienced issues such as static, interrupted communications, and prolonged periods—sometimes up to nine hours—without contact with mission control.

Currently, astronauts aboard the International Space Station (ISS) have access to email and live video conferencing, which enhance their morale and support their needs more effectively than the previously limited and delayed communication methods.

However, real-time communication is heavily reliant on continuous technological advancements. Factors such as time delays due to the vast distance between Earth and space, equipment failures, and the reliance on ground support can complicate interactions.

Consequently, astronauts must anticipate and adapt to these issues. Implementing effective communication strategies is essential to mitigating these challenges and maintaining a connection with Earth. These strategies are critical to ensuring the well-being and operational efficiency of crew members during their missions.

Impact on Public Interest and STEM Inspiration

Astronauts have utilized social media to enhance public interest in space exploration and to promote STEM (Science, Technology, Engineering, and Mathematics) careers. By sharing experiences and imagery from the International Space Station (ISS), astronauts such as ESA's André Kuipers and Paolo Nespoli provide a firsthand perspective on life in space.

This direct access allows individuals to engage in live Q&A sessions and participate in interactive discussions, thereby making the topic of space exploration more relatable and accessible.

The impact of these social media efforts can be measured by increased engagement with educational content and initiatives aimed at inspiring the next generation in STEM fields. Research indicates that exposure to space science and technology through personal accounts can encourage students to pursue education and careers in these areas.

Additionally, the portrayal of astronauts as relatable figures contributes to the public's understanding and appreciation of scientific endeavors.

Future Innovations for Deep Space Connectivity

As social media increasingly engages the public with developments in space exploration, technological advancements are concurrently addressing the challenges associated with deep space connectivity. Upcoming innovations, including relay satellite networks, aim to reduce communication blackout periods, aligning with the practical requirements of interplanetary communication.

Given that Mars missions may experience communication delays of up to 12 minutes, future systems are being designed to deliver real-time updates despite the significant distances involved.

The testing of the BEAM (Bigelow Expandable Activity Module) highlights the critical role of reliable communication technologies in supporting human missions to Mars. Effective communication is essential for maintaining operational efficiency and morale among astronauts.

Enhanced bandwidth and improved video calling capabilities are likely to be key components in these systems, facilitating better interaction with mission control and increasing the psychological well-being of crews during extended missions far from Earth.
